Osteoporosis prevention is something that concerns many women around the world. Osteoporosis can be described as a skeletal disease that is progressive, meaning it usually becomes steadily worse over time. The disease is characterized by fragile bones, low bone density, and a susceptibility to fractures of the hip, wrist, and spine. Osteoporosis is mainly found in women who are over the age of 50, however younger women are just as susceptible. Most women won't even realize they have osteoporosis, as there are no warning signs of the disease. The first sign of osteoporosis is when a woman experiences a minor fall that causes broken bones.
